Background
The SF6 density relay is an important protection and control element in a power system, if a breaker fails, great economic loss is caused, and in order to ensure the operation reliability of the breaker, various indexes of the breaker, particularly SF6 gas, must be monitored frequently to meet the regulation of relevant standards so that the SF6 breaker can keep a good working state for a long time. However, the SF6 density relay device is basically used outdoors for a long time, is greatly influenced by rainwater, dust and the like, has a severe service environment, and can cause rainwater if a protective cover is not additionally arranged. Dust permeates through the density relay, pollutes SF6 gas, reduces equipment performance index, and then threatens equipment safe operation. The existing open type rain-proof cover has poor rain-proof effect and no dustproof effect, the totally-closed protective cover is inconvenient to maintain, the observation window is easy to have internal dirt, maintenance personnel are inconvenient to disassemble, the observation window cannot be cleaned from the inside, and the real-time monitoring of SF6 gas is troublesome.

Detailed Description
A convenient to dismantle and wash rain-proof dust cover of SF6 density relay, as shown in fig. 1, including casing 1, as shown in fig. 2, casing 1 is the box-like of bottom open-type, has SF6 density relay 2 at 1 internally mounted of casing, installs detachable L template 3 on casing 1's the back lateral wall, SF6 density relay 2 fixed connection is on the vertical board of L template 3, the horizontal plate of L template 3 bottom stretches out casing 1 for fixed connection is on all the other power system equipment. A horizontal plug board 4 is welded at the bottom position of a vertical board of the L-shaped board 3, the plug board 4 is positioned at the bottom position in the shell 1, a connector base 5 is fixedly installed on the plug board 4, and a connector 6 of the SF6 density relay 2 penetrates through the connector base 5 and extends out of the bottom of the shell 1.
A baffle 7 is arranged between two side walls of the shell 1 at the front end of the SF6 density relay 2, and the plugboard 4 is positioned between the baffle 7 and the rear side wall of the shell 1, so that the SF6 density relay 2 can be conveniently positioned when being installed. Leave through-hole 8 on baffle 7, through-hole 8 corresponds SF6 density relay 2's gauge outfit 9 position, installs detachable observation window mounting panel 10 on baffle 7, is equipped with transparent glass piece 11 in the observation window mounting panel 10, glass piece 11 covers the position department at through-hole 8. The front end of observation window mounting panel 10 is for opening and shutting door 12, opening and shutting door 12 is installed on the preceding lateral wall of casing 1 through the pivot 13 at its top, the bottom position department of opening and shutting door 12 still is equipped with pull ring 14, when needing to carry out data observation to SF6 density relay 2, operating personnel only need hold pull ring 14, along pivot 13 with opening and shutting door 12 turn to horizontal position can follow the glass piece 11 in the observation window mounting panel 10 and observe the reading data of the inside SF6 density relay 2 of casing 1, the simple operation is easy, the setting of opening and shutting door 12 has still played abundant guard action to the inside SF6 density relay 2.
Preferably, in order to get in time clear up when dirty appears in glass piece 11 in observation window mounting panel 10, be connected through butterfly bolt 15 between observation window mounting panel 10 and the baffle 7, butterfly bolt 15 connects fastening and convenient to detach, and operating personnel needn't can carry out bare-handed dismantlement with the help of appurtenance such as screwdriver spanner, and it is comparatively convenient and can clean it thoroughly to maintain, avoids because of the reading deviation that dirty shelters from and cause on the glass piece 11.
Preferably, sealing rubber strips 16 are installed on the periphery of the joint of the opening and closing door 12 and the front side wall of the shell 1, magnets 17 are arranged between the opening and closing door 12 and the baffle 7, the magnets 17 are located between two side walls of the shell 1, the opening and closing door 12 is made of ferromagnetic materials, the magnets 17 can be attracted and fixed with the opening and closing door 12 when the opening and closing door 12 is in a closed state, the sealing rubber strips 16 and the magnets 17 are arranged, the rainproof and dustproof performance of the shell 1 is further guaranteed, and the normal operation of the internal SF6 density relay 2 is guaranteed.
Preferably, the upper portion of the opening and closing door 12 is provided with a shade 18, the shade 18 is fixedly arranged outside the front side wall of the shell 1, and due to the arrangement of the shade 18, even if an operator opens the opening and closing door 12 in rainy days to observe data of the SF6 density relay 2, rainwater cannot enter the shell 1, and the opening and closing door 12 and the SF6 density relay 2 inside the shell are further protected.
